Web30 dec. 2024 · H2O2 molecular geometry is bent and electron geometry is tetrahedral. The bond angle of H2O2 in the gas phase is 94.8º and in the solid phase, it is 101.9º. … Web31 jan. 2024 · Electron Configuration of oxygen (O) = 2, 6 We can see the outer most shell of oxygen has 6 electrons so, have to subtract it from 8. 8 – 6 = 2 That’s why valency of oxygen is 2. Note: In general, oxygen has a stable oxidation state of -2 in most of the compounds but it may vary in some compounds due to the different bond stability.
WebThe arrangement of electrons in oxygen in specific rules in different orbits and orbitals is called the electron configuration of oxygen. The electron configuration of oxygen is 1s 2 2s 2 2p 4, if the electron arrangement is through orbitals. Electron configuration can be done in two ways.
